Title of article :
Xyloglucan from soybean (Glycine max) meal is composed of XXXG-type building units

Abstract :
Soybean cell wall material was depectinated by extraction with a hot chelating agent and a cold dilute alkali. The hemicelluloses were solubilised from the residue with 1 and 4 M KOH solutions, resulting in 1 M Alkali Soluble Solids (1 MASS) and 4 M Alkali Soluble Solids (4 MASS) fractions. The polysaccharides extracted with 1 M KOH were fractionated by ion-exchange chromatography, yielding a neutral and a pectic population. The sugar composition of the neutral population indicated the presence of xyloglucans and possibly xylans. Enzymatic degradation with endoxylanases and endo-glucanases showed the presence of xyloglucans only. Analysis of the digest formed after incubation of the neutral population with endo-glucanase V using both HPAEC and MALDI-TOF MS showed the formation of the characteristic poly-XXXG xyloglucan oligomers (XXG, XXXG, XXFG, XLXG, and XLFG).
